Abstract:

When considering the benefits of Foreign Direct Investments (FDI) -consitute a large portion of international capital movement and provide a great benefit to economic growth to the country's economy in the point of employment, technology, business knowledge, integration to the international markets. In this study, a analysis has been done to see whether it makes the mentioned influence or contribution in Turkey and whether it supports the theory or not. Johansen-Juselius Cointegration and Granger causality tests are applied between FDI and Gross Domestic Product (GDP) variables that represent the economic growth. At the end of the study, it is FDI and GDP are cointration and that there exists bidirectional causality between FDI and gross domestic product
